Question 15?

If any of you have the dart trading cards--you'll notice that in the Gilligan biography info it states his age as 15. This is really ridiculous as he is obviously not even a teenager, but in his 20's. Why do they say this? Is this from the show's "treatment" that is described in the "Before The 3 Hour Tour" segment on the 1st season DVD? They also list Ginger's age as 25. This is more believable but do you think she's really so close in age to Gilligan?

In "Meet the Meteor," the end of season two, and presumably the end of their second year on the island, Gilligan gives us his age: 22. The people doing the Dart trading cards just got sloppy. There are some other things there that were never mentioned as canon: the Skipper being from Seattle, Washington, Mr. Howell being from Gros Pointe, Michigan...I have no idea where they came up with this stuff.

The first season dvd says that in one of the early treatments, Gilligan and the Skipper weren't buddies from the navy. Gilligan was a last-minute replacement for the Skipper's real first mate, who had become ill. I'm so glad they changed this. It was the strength of their long friendship that helped them weather all those blunders and mishaps!

Oh, and as for Ginger...I always thought she was a little older than 25. Maybe 28 in Season 1? Hard to say. But it would add to her fears of becoming a has-been if she's nearing 30.
